How does CNR work technically with the Ubuntu system?

0

CNR is added to the standard Ubuntu software installation method to complement existing functionality and provide Ubuntu users with easy access to commercial products and proprietary drivers. Since CNR adheres to and works in parallel with standard Ubuntu software installation methods, users can choose to use Ubuntu’s standard installation method, CNR, or a combination of them to download and install thousands of additional programs and packages.
